This Week­end: FIG­MENT NYC Festival

This week­end Gov­er­nors Island is host­ing the annu­al FIG­MENT NYC Fes­ti­val which fea­tures an explo­sion of cre­ative ener­gy” where vis­i­tors can observe and inter­act with over 200 artists locat­ed in dif­fer­ent areas around the island! The Tree­house, unique minia­ture golf course, and inter­ac­tive sculp­ture gar­den will stay until Sep­tem­ber 23. Both kids and adults will enjoy this cre­ative, crowd-pleas­ing fes­ti­val!   • See an acclaimed per­for­mance of Amelia” in Fort Jay at 3 PM on Sat­ur­day and Sun­day. Tick­ets are required but they are free!
  • Vis­it the top of the new­ly re-opened Cas­tle Williams with a Nation­al Park Ser­vice Ranger. Timed tick­ets are free and avail­able at the gaze­bo out­side of the Castle.
  • Stop by Coop­er-Hewitt Nation­al Design Museum’s incred­i­ble exhi­bi­tion Graph­ic Design – Now in Pro­duc­tion” in Build­ing 110
  • Head over to the Gov­er­nors Gal­leries to stop by Bet­ter than Jam’s Pop Up Shop, bring the kids to Mu Math for some fun and inter­ac­tive rid­dles and math games, and see exhibits by the Sculp­tors Guild, Empire His­toric Arts and Storm King Art Center.
  • Vis­it the goats and chick­ens and learn more about com­post­ing at the Earth Mat­ter Com­post Learn­ing Cen­ter near Pic­nic Point.
